Application Process
There is no general admission at the graduate level at SFU; you must apply directly to the Global Humanities MA Program. Applications are accepted through the Graduate Studies online goGRAD system beginning October 15 for Fall 2025 admissions.
If you are applying to Fall 2025, in order to upload the required documents to complete your application, you will need to pay a non-refundable application fee of $110 CAD (domestic students with Canadian credentials only) or $150 CAD (domestic and international students with international credentials) by credit card (MasterCard or Visa).

Application Deadlines
Admissions are for Fall intake only. Applications and all supporting documents must be submitted by January 15 in the year of admission.
Note: admission to the Accelerated Master's Program can occur in any semester.
Department Admission Procedures
Applications for admission are adjudicated by the Global Humanities Graduate Program Committee (GPC) in consultation with appropriate members of the Department.
When an application is completed, it is reviewed by the GPC. Admission decisions will be based on materials submitted within the application.
Generally speaking, the GPC will make one of the following recommendations:
- Applicant is admitted into the program (with or without conditions).
- Applicant is admitted as a Qualifying Student. The applicant may be required to take up to 12 hours of additional work in the Global Humanities Undergraduate Program. The GPC will specify these requirements to the incoming student.
- Application for admission is rejected.
- The GPC can require further information from the applicant and delay its decision.
Note: all applications are subject to final approval by the University’s Senate Graduate Studies Committee, and Graduate Studies will send out all final offer letters.

important notes
- Applicants must meet both the University and Department requirements to be considered for admission.
- The Global Humanities MA Program will only admit applicants with clearly defined research project proposals that alight with faculty expertise.
- All applications, including writing samples, must be completed in English.
- It is not possible to acknowledge receipt of applications; however, you may check your application status online during the application period as this information is updated regularly.
- Incomplete files and applications will not be reviewed.
